Jeff LaJoie
c3bb21c714
Merge pull request #17904 from edx/jlajoie/LEARNER-4578
...
LEARNER-4578: Adds in JQuery password validation on Studio
2018-04-12 12:12:56 -04:00
Jeff LaJoie
aeb85c59d3
LEARNER-4578: Adds in password validation on Studio
2018-04-09 15:26:12 -04:00
Farhanah Sheets
facb03ebd3
Remove search settings and add test to validate search visibility
2018-04-09 14:38:35 -04:00
Tyler Hallada
71e74949e9
Change in-context waffle switch to a flag
...
Also update studio-frontend to version 1.7.1
2018-04-05 16:47:42 -04:00
Tyler Hallada
d31249ba20
Studio-frontend in-context image selection modal
...
Open edit image modal via a custom signal
Send img tag attributes in open signal
Send natural image dimensions if no attr specified
Add new modal button in addition to old button
Also load built CSS when waffle switch on
Swap out TinyMCE toolbar button on waffle switch
Pass LANGUAGE_CODE from Django to template to studio-frontend
Define request.LANGUAGE_CODE in test_container_page.py
2018-04-04 15:48:36 -04:00
Michael Roytman
c9c97e58c5
Merge pull request #17700 from edx/mroytman/studio-link-to-lms
...
Link to LMS from Studio footer
2018-03-28 16:14:28 -04:00
Michael Roytman
a0ed8fa38d
Add a link to the LMS from Studio footer.
2018-03-28 14:10:30 -04:00
Tyler Hallada
04279bf5af
Refer to new sfe file names in templates
2018-03-27 15:17:58 -04:00
Farhanah Sheets
b6469642fd
Merge pull request #17599 from edx/fsheets/EDUCATOR-2324
...
Clean up old Studio Assets Page
2018-03-08 14:06:02 -05:00
Farhanah Sheets
8dd967448f
Remove old assets page from mako template, tests, & config model references
2018-03-08 12:05:08 -05:00
Calen Pennington
970bc6a50d
Move the context course and sock into require_page compatible forms
2018-03-06 15:35:46 -05:00
Ari Rizzitano
6998b311fe
fix page_bundle
2018-03-06 15:35:46 -05:00
Rabia Iftikhar
3be942bf8f
upgrade backbone-associations, fix tests
...
Merge pull request #17559 from edx/ri/EDUCATOR-2231-remove-enrollment-dates-references
EDUCATOR-2231 remove course run enrollment dates references from studio
add NoTextbooks component
make backbone-associations work
webpackify context course
test fixup
2018-03-06 15:30:56 -05:00
Calen Pennington
c45de5c32b
Revert "Revert "Revert "Merge pull request #17325 from cpennington/switch-ass…"
2018-02-28 11:06:39 -05:00
Calen Pennington
7f6c101284
Merge pull request #17565 from edx/re-add-asset-index-changes
...
Revert "Revert "Merge pull request #17325 from cpennington/switch-ass…
2018-02-27 21:28:02 -05:00
Calen Pennington
b1c9ad175d
Revert "Revert "Merge pull request #17325 from cpennington/switch-asset-index-factory-to-webpack""
...
This reverts commit 67177ac72d .
The original PR cause a breakage on production due to webpack building two different
copies of the asset_index.js bundle. However, it is unclear whether that was a
transitory issue or not. This commit restores the original PR to validate whether
the problem is reproducible.
2018-02-27 16:18:27 -05:00
Dennis Jen
6da648899f
Merge pull request #17530 from edx/dsjen/assets-search-waffle
...
Added waffle switch for files & uploads search UI
2018-02-27 14:56:10 -05:00
Eric Fischer
2717ef5b80
Provide i18n data to SFE in DOM
...
EDUCATOR-1613, edx-platform changes
2018-02-27 10:17:35 -05:00
Bill DeRusha
d4b57bc218
Removed self-paced feature flag from code
2018-02-26 13:44:53 -05:00
Calen Pennington
67177ac72d
Revert "Merge pull request #17325 from cpennington/switch-asset-index-factory-to-webpack"
...
This reverts commit 1c46bd89c3 , reversing
changes made to eb6064e333 .
2018-02-22 14:12:32 -05:00
Dennis Jen
bcb8cfeffd
Added waffle switch for files & uploads search UI
2018-02-22 11:54:53 -05:00
Calen Pennington
c906c186ce
Move the context course and sock into require_page compatible forms
2018-02-21 10:29:41 -05:00
Calen Pennington
569066edf5
Convert cms/static/js/factories/asset_index.js to be bundled using webpack
2018-02-21 10:29:41 -05:00
Tyler Hallada
6707f8d428
Add class=SFE to AccessibilityPage root div
2018-02-15 13:20:19 -05:00
Tyler Hallada
682365a1dd
Remove loading spinner in new assets page
2018-02-15 13:20:19 -05:00
Tyler Hallada
3578a72d0f
Fix waffle flag switch on old assets JS block
2018-02-15 13:20:19 -05:00
Tyler Hallada
3e7a742177
Fix integration of accessibility policy page
2018-02-15 13:20:18 -05:00
Tyler Hallada
73cffad5ce
Dev in sfe container & prod use /dist of sfe
2018-02-15 13:20:18 -05:00
Michael Roytman
3496bb9a0a
pass language to mako template
2018-02-12 15:44:20 -05:00
Ned Batchelder
60a4e6d864
Merge pull request #17339 from caesar2164/make-studio-sock-links-themable
...
Define Studio sock links in separate themable file
2018-02-08 15:20:22 -05:00
Giulio Gratta
2fbe81b666
Move extra links import into new file
2018-01-31 13:11:59 -08:00
Giulio Gratta
9e96e29979
Clean up link list coalescence
2018-01-30 16:27:36 -08:00
Calen Pennington
f2c3aed8e7
Merge pull request #17316 from cpennington/switch-cms-login-to-webpack
...
Migrate login.js to webpack
2018-01-30 14:24:08 -05:00
Calen Pennington
b701ad77c8
Rename require_page to invoke_page_bundle
2018-01-30 10:32:31 -05:00
Calen Pennington
5772042199
Migrate login.js to webpack
2018-01-30 10:32:31 -05:00
Giulio Gratta
4cbcc5ed52
Add file to allow simple extension of sock links
2018-01-29 13:26:08 -08:00
Giulio Gratta
156b501e47
Define Studio sock links in separate themable file
2018-01-29 11:56:20 -08:00
Ned Batchelder
921ea67cac
Merge pull request #17312 from caesar2164/allow-theming-files-uploads-header
...
Allows insertion of content above Files & Uploads
2018-01-26 15:38:12 -05:00
Giulio Gratta
5b0344d87f
Allows insertion of content above Files & Uploads
2018-01-25 13:11:55 -08:00
Giulio Gratta
794630824e
Extends <head> in Studio course outline
...
- Can add meta, link, and script tags
- Adds to rather than replaces edX tags
2018-01-25 11:28:06 -08:00
Calen Pennington
974f099835
Teach the xss_linter about the require_page tag
2018-01-23 15:58:12 -05:00
Calen Pennington
58bb7167c1
Convert cms login.html to the require_page pattern in preparation for webpack
2018-01-18 13:49:44 -05:00
Calen Pennington
bacd4334ed
Add a form of static:require_module that assumes that the factory is self-initializing
2018-01-18 10:10:30 -05:00
Tyler Hallada
8dcba2737a
If SFE enabled, hide sidebar and upload button
2018-01-17 15:34:02 -05:00
Jeremy Bowman
113e8dde61
PLAT-1885 Stop using deprecated BlockUsageLocator properties
2018-01-12 16:40:21 -05:00
Mushtaq Ali
6af1215bcd
Add delete js tests
2018-01-12 15:25:00 +05:00
Qubad786
55001ca81a
Transcript delete on Video Upload Page - EDUCATOR-1961
2018-01-11 13:08:07 +05:00
Mushtaq Ali
c0d86360f0
Improve trancript sorting - EDUCATOR-2030
2018-01-10 17:02:21 +05:00
Mushtaq Ali
70fe33fc1e
Change upload button text
2018-01-09 17:03:48 +05:00
Mushtaq Ali
f76d419bc7
Fix download transcript bug - EDUCATOR-2071
2018-01-09 17:03:48 +05:00